Published in 2019 at "Physical Chemistry Research"
DOI: 10.22036/pcr.2019.172684.1597
Abstract: Substitution effects are probed for novel N-heterocyclic stannylenes (NHSns), including 1,4-di(R)-tetrazole-5-stannylenes (1R), and 1,3-di(R)-tetrazole-5-stannylenes (2R), using B3LYP/6-311++G** level of theory. Nucleophilicity, multiplicity, and stability of 1R and 2R are calculated; with R = H, methyl,…
